We stayed in room 418. It was quiet with a lovely view of the mountains. Absolutely loved the layout of the room. It was really spacious with a loft bedroom, kitchenette, living room and 2 bathrooms. We were thrilled to discover that it had a spa bathtub and sauna. The front Desk service was excellent. They even called to make sure we had everything we needed after check in. And were helpful in directing us where to go on our outings. We enjoyed the Irish pub and Old spaghetti Factory that were located close by. We will definitely stay again.
The only "negative" was the the parking fee being $25 a day. The hot water for the tub was very slow and the a few things were a bit worn. Not a big deal to us. Just mentioned because It may be for some.

The set-up with kitchenette, nook to eat, murphy bed - made good use of the space. The fridge is spacious and also had a freezer section which was very handy. The room was clean and had a fireplace. Very good for the value (I stayed there during the off season for a conference). It is very well situated - near the conference centre and grocery as well as the walking trails leading to Lost Lake. I really enjoyed my stay due to this convenience.
The alarm clock could not be disconnected (for some reason, it had gone off a few times in the middle of the night even though it had not been set and looked like it should have been off). This was an unfortunate experience, and the staff were very sorry and tried to deal with the issue as best they could. It would have been nice to have a kettle and/or some pots (there is a coffee maker and frying pans - and all the utensils needed). The other thing that marred the otherwise lovely experience was that it was quite noisy at night due to folks drinking and partying at a nearby establishment (which may be due to where my room was situated).

Location of the property is fantastic. Convenient walking distance to both sides of the village, upper village and trails. Front desk staff were incredibly nice and helpful. The loft suite was very comfortable. Fireplace was awesome! Suite had everything we needed. Fully equipped kitchen. We were very happy for the price we paid.
We were informed the morning of travel that the pool and hot tub areas were closed. Not a big deal, but it came up rather last minute. The rooms are dated, especially the bathrooms, but again, not a big deal for us. We had an end unit which was nice as we only had one noisy next door neighbour instead of 2. Potential to be very noisy if located in a middle suite and the hotel is fully occupied.
